随笔分类 -  Java基础

摘要:题目 比较常见的问题,因为比较细,看书的时候一不注意可能就过去啦,但是遇到的时候就会容易出问题。先看下面程序,考虑一下运行结果是什么呢? int x = 1, y = 1; if(x++ == 2 && ++y == 2){ x = 8; } System.out.println("x = " + x + ", y = " + y); 虽然很短的一个小程序,但是考察了两个细节,分别是... 阅读全文
posted @ 2019-12-02 19:58 ChatGIS 阅读(752) 评论(0) 推荐(0)
摘要:参考 常规类型的格式化 String类的format()方法用于创建格式化的字符串以及连接多个字符串对象。熟悉C语言的同学应该记得C语言的sprintf()方法,两者有类似之处。format()方法有两种重载形式。 format(String format, Object... args) 新字符串 阅读全文
posted @ 2018-05-22 15:52 ChatGIS 阅读(179) 评论(0) 推荐(0)
摘要:学习笔记 一、继承 1、继承是java面向对象编程技术的一块基石,因为它允许创建分等级层次的类。 2、Java的继承是单继承,不可以像接口一样多继承,但是可以多重继承,单继承就是一个子类只能继承一个父类,多重继承就是,例如A类继承B类,B类继承C类,所以按照关系就是C类是B类的父类,B类是A类的父类 阅读全文
posted @ 2018-04-13 12:30 ChatGIS 阅读(142) 评论(0) 推荐(0)
摘要:转载只为个人学习,阅读请前往原地址:传送门 开发中经常遇到从集合类List、Map中取出数据转换为String的问题,这里如果处理不好,经常会遇到空指针异常java.lang.NullPointerException,在此总结一下常用转换为String的方法,以及转换后如何对其进行判null使用的问 阅读全文
posted @ 2018-03-30 09:07 ChatGIS 阅读(369)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2018-01-16 09:13 ChatGIS 阅读(134) 评论(0) 推荐(0)
摘要:用于个人参考,查看请前往原地址http://blog.csdn.net/springk/article/details/6414017 问题讨论http://bbs.csdn.net/topics/240058667 在Java项目的实际开发和应用中,常常需要用到将对象转为String这一基本功能。 阅读全文
posted @ 2017-12-10 11:15 ChatGIS 阅读(197) 评论(0) 推荐(0)
摘要:转载只为个人学习,阅读请前往原地址:Java for循环的几种用法详解 本文主要是来了解一下Java中的几种for循环用法,分析得十分详细,一起来看看。 J2SE 1.5提供了另一种形式的for循环。借助这种形式的for循环,可以用更简单地方式来遍历数组和Collection等类型的对象。本文介绍使 阅读全文
posted @ 2017-11-10 09:18 ChatGIS 阅读(340) 评论(0) 推荐(0)
摘要:==比较引用,equals 比较值 1、java中字符串的比较:== 我们经常习惯性的写上if(str1==str2),这种写法在java中可能会带来问题 example1: 那么a==b将返回true。因为在java中字符串的值是不可改变的,相同的字符串在内存中只会存 一份,所以a和b指向的是同一 阅读全文
posted @ 2017-11-09 15:25 ChatGIS 阅读(215268) 评论(2) 推荐(5)
摘要:详细地址:http://blog.csdn.net/lonely_fireworks/article/details/7962171/ 标 志 说 明 示 例 结 果 + 为正数或者负数添加符号 ("%+d",15) +15 − 左对齐 ("%-5d",15) |15 | 0 数字前面补0 ("%0 阅读全文
posted @ 2017-11-06 21:52 ChatGIS 阅读(818) 评论(0) 推荐(0)
摘要:转载只供个人学习参考,以下查看请前往原出处:http://blog.csdn.net/wangchangshuai0010/article/details/8577982 我们经常要将数字进行格式化,比如取2位小数,这是最常见的。Java 提供 DecimalFormat 类,帮你用最快的速度将数字 阅读全文
posted @ 2017-11-06 21:40 ChatGIS 阅读(258) 评论(0) 推荐(0)
摘要:转载只供个人学习参考,以下查看请前往原出处:http://www.cnblogs.com/lxl57610/p/5822415.html 在Java中有一套设计优良的接口和类组成了Java集合框架,使程序员操作成批的数据或对象元素极为方便。所有的Java集合都在java.util包中。 在编写程序的 阅读全文
posted @ 2017-11-06 21:25 ChatGIS 阅读(237) 评论(0) 推荐(0)